Skip to content

This website uses cookies to provide features and services. By using the site you agree to the use of cookies.Cookie policy.  Close

MINNEAPOLIS, MN Full Time Posted: Wednesday, 15 January 2020
At Ingersoll Rand we are passionate about inspiring progress around the world. We advance the quality of life by creating comfortable, sustainable and efficient environments. Our people and our family of brands-including Club Car®, Ingersoll Rand®, Thermo King®, Trane®, American Standard® Heating & Air Conditioning and ARO® - work together to enhance the quality and comfort of air in homes and buildings; transport and protect food and perishables; and increase industrial productivity and efficiency. We are a global business committed to a world of sustainable progress and enduring results. For more information, visit

Ingersoll Rand is a diverse and inclusive environment. We are an equal opportunity employer, dedicated to hiring a diverse workforce; including individuals with disabilities and United States qualified protected veterans.

Job Summary:

This Senior Controls Engineer will work as a member of the Global Control Systems Center of Excellence supporting Thermo King transport refrigeration system development. This role will support the execution of Embedded controls development projects, working with hardware, software, validation test and system integration functions.

Core Job Responsibilities (others may be added):
  • Develop models for system-level control algorithms and functionality that provide superior performance, enhance reliability and diagnostics.
  • Execute simulation, rapid experiments and concept validation testing.
  • Support system and sub-system level integration testing to insure control system behavior meets implicit and explicit requirements. Review and analyze system test data.
  • Auto-generate code and work with software integration teams to build system functionality.
  • Align with organizational development standards and processes.
  • Collaborate with product management and system integration teams.
  • Drive project execution and achieve project milestones.
  • 10% travel anticipated.

Minimum Qualifications:

  • Bachelor's Degree in Engineering, Computer Science, Physics or Mathematics and at least 5 years' experience in controls, electronics or systems engineering is required.

Key Competencies:

  • Understanding of control system design including instrumentation, HMIs, communication networks, and distributed systems. Classical control knowledge required (PID control, linear control, digital filtering). Advanced control knowledge preferred (modern control theory, model predictive control, non-linear control, adaptive control, fuzzy logic).
  • Understanding of optimization techniques is preferred.
  • Experience with model based design processes and modeling & simulation of complex systems is required. Proficiency with Mathworks tools such as Matlab, Simulink, Stateflow is required. Proficiency in SVN, Jenkins or Dymola beneficial.
  • Experience with MAAB, J-MAAB, IEC 62304 or equivalents are preferred.
  • Experience in automating processes is preferred.
  • Knowledge in refrigeration, vapor compression or thermodynamics/fluid dynamics is a plus.
  • Knowledge in compressors, engines or power electronics is a plus.

We are committed to helping you reach your professional, personal and financial goals. We offer competitive compensation that aligns with our business strategies and comprehensive benefits to help you live your healthiest. We are committed to building an inclusive and diverse culture that engages as well as values the different backgrounds and experiences of our employee, which, in turn, spurs innovation, generates creative solutions and enhances our customer relations.

If you share our passion for inspiring progress-for bringing about bold shifts in how people, economies and societies operate-then you belong with Ingersoll Rand. Progress begins with you!

MINNEAPOLIS, MN, United States of America
Ingersoll Rand
Click apply
1/15/2020 8:34:24 AM

We strongly recommend that you should never provide your bank account details to an advertiser during the job application process. Should you receive a request of this nature please contact support giving the advertiser's name and job reference.

Other jobs like this